Looks promising. I wonder what the difference is between this new leader and the STS Steelhead. The characteristics charts are pretty much the same; even the diameters are the same, except the new leader is a little more expensive. 

  • BassResource.com Administrator
Posted

This is an excellent question. The characteristics for Pounce and STS are similar because the products are targeting species of fish that spend their time in environments that have some very similar characteristics like rocks, weeds and wood.

 
For that reason, both offer exceptional abrasion resistance and strength and deliver all the other benefits of fluorocarbon like fast sink rate, low stretch and invisibility.

 

Diameters for most Seaguar lines are the same for the lb test sizes as they are all built to conform to the proper break strength. There are a few exceptions in line diameter sizes but not many. Both Pounce and STS are made from 100% Seaguar fluorocarbon resins.

 

Unlike STS, Pounce is targeting bass anglers - both the casual weekend angler and those that fish local tournaments.  Also, Pounce is on 25 yard spools to help keep the price affordable and enable anglers to buy several spools of different lb. test sizes to meet different application needs. Lastly but important, Pounce is merchandised in a box instead of the typical “Leader Ring”.  Hopefully this adds a little familiarity to bass anglers who are not always used to seeing leader spools on retail displays.
